Ingredients
- 2 cups fresh strawberries, hulled and sliced
- 1 cup fresh rhubarb, cut into 1-inch pieces
- 1/2 cup granulated sugar
- 2 tablespoons cornstarch
- 1/4 cup all-purpose flour
- 1/2 cup rolled oats
- 1/2 cup brown sugar
- 1/2 cup cold unsalted butter, cut into small pieces
- 1 teaspoon cinnamon
- 1/4 teaspoon nutmeg
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
Instructions
- Step 1: Prepare the Filling – In a large bowl, combine the sliced strawberries and rhubarb. In a small bowl, whisk together the granulated sugar and cornstarch, then sprinkle the mixture over the strawberry and rhubarb mixture, tossing to coat.
- Step 2: Prepare the Crumble Topping – In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our, rolled oats, brown sugar, cinnamon, nutmeg, and salt. Add the cold butter to the dry ingredients and use your fingers or a pastry blender to work the butter into the mixture until it resembles coarse crumbs.
- Step 3: Assemble the Bars – Press half of the crumble topping into a 9×9-inch baking dish. Top with the strawberry and rhubarb filling, then sprinkle the remaining crumble topping over the filling.
- Step 4: Bake the Bars – Bake the bars in a preheated oven at 375°F (190°C) for 40-45 minutes, or until the topping is golden brown and the filling is bubbly.
Handy Tips
- Make sure to use fresh and high-quality ingredients, especially the strawberries and rhubarb, to ensure the best flavor and texture.
- To avoid a soggy crust, make sure to press the crumble topping into the baking dish firmly and evenly.
- Don’t overmix the crumble topping, as this can cause it to become tough and dense.
Heat Control
To ensure the bars are cooked to perfection, keep an eye on the temperature and timing. The ideal temperature for baking the bars is 375°F (190°C), and the baking time should be around 40-45 minutes. Check the bars for doneness by looking for a golden brown crust and a bubbly filling.
Crunch Factor
The crunch factor in these bars comes from the crumbly oat and brown sugar topping. To achieve the perfect crunch, make sure to use cold butter and don’t overmix the topping. You can also try adding some chopped nuts or seeds to the topping for extra texture and flavor.

Troubleshooting
- If the crust is too soggy, try baking the bars for a few minutes longer or using a higher oven temperature.
- If the filling is too runny, try adding a little bit more cornstarch or flour to thicken it up.
- If the bars are too crumbly, try using a little bit more butter or adding some extra oats to the topping.
FAQs
- Can I freeze the bars? Yes, the bars can be frozen for up to 2 months. Simply wrap them tightly in plastic wrap or aluminum foil and thaw them overnight in the fridge before serving.
- Are the bars gluten-free? No, the bars contain wheat flour and are not gluten-free. However, you can try substituting the wheat flour with a gluten-free flour blend to make the bars gluten-free.
- Can I double the recipe? Yes, you can double the recipe to make a larger batch of bars. Simply multiply all the ingredients by two and bake the bars in a larger baking dish.
